Xmas is one of one of the most magical times of the year, and several destinations all over the world go all out to produce an enchanting holiday ambience. From picturesque communities covered in snow to dynamic cities aglow with festive lights, there are lots of areas to celebrate the holiday season in vogue.

For a classic European Christmas experience, absolutely nothing defeats the charm of Strasbourg, France. Referred to as the "Resources of Xmas," this city boasts one of the earliest Xmas markets in Europe, going back to the 16th century. The entire city centre transforms into a winter months wonderland, with over 300 wooden stalls offering handcrafted items, mulled wine, and festive treats. Strasbourg's gothic basilica and middle ages half-timbered residences, covered in twinkling lights and decors, create a fairy-tale environment. Visitors can likewise appreciate ice skating, carolling, and neighborhood Xmas traditions, such as the Saint Nicholas parade. Strasbourg offers an idyllic blend of history, culture, and holiday cheer, making it a top destination for anybody seeking a joyful European getaway.

For those trying to find an absolutely enchanting winter months retreat, Rovaniemi in Finnish Lapland is tough to defeat. Called the main home town of Santa Claus, read more Rovaniemi is the best destination for households and children eager to meet Father Xmas. Below, site visitors can check out Santa Claus Village, send letters from the official Santa Post Office, and also take a reindeer sleigh adventure via the snowy Arctic wild. The spectacular natural beauty of the area, with its snow-covered woodlands and regular screens of the Northern Lights, includes in the delight. Past the Christmas festivities, Rovaniemi supplies a selection of wintertime activities, including pet sledding, snowmobiling, and sees to conventional Sámi reindeer farms, making certain an absolutely extraordinary winter season getaway.

For an extra tropical spin on the holiday, Madeira, Portugal provides a cozy and joyful Christmas experience. The island's resources, Funchal, is renowned for its fancy Christmas lights, attractive nativity scenes, and grand fireworks show on New Year's Eve. During December, the streets of Funchal are full of music, typical folk dances, and food stalls providing local specials like bolo de mel (honey cake) and poncha (a local alcoholic drink). Visitors can additionally take a beautiful cable car adventure as much as Monte, a hill village, to appreciate scenic sights of the city and surrounding countryside. With its light winter season temperature levels, Madeira is a terrific alternative for those who intend to delight in the vacation spirit without the cold, using both leisure and festive joy.
